Pikes Peak Road Runners (PPRR) and the Trails and Open Space Coalition (TOSC) have collaborated again to bring a unique challenge in 2021; in place of the long-running American Discovery Trail races, participate in a new hybrid challenge!

The two organizations have worked together for years to hold the ADT Marathon, Half Marathon, and 10k races, where all proceeds were given back to our community. We are dedicated to trail stewardship and community running events striving to make the Pikes Peak Region a great place to live and be active as a family. Please help continue this community-based effort by running a unique challenge and contributing to our important community cause.

PPRR was informed early in 2020 that the City of Colorado Springs would not be allowing any events to take place in America the Beautiful Park due to the construction of the Olympic museum and pedestrian bridge. We immediately started searching for new venues to hold a quality event. COVID-19 then gripped the world and instead of canceling the ADT races all together, we reimagined what racing to benefit our community could look like in 2020, creating the Two Shoes Trek Challenge / 2020 Virtual.

The Two Shoes Trek Challenge has evolved for 2021 to include a live event which will take place in El Paso County’s Fox Run Regional Park. Along with the Fox Run event, a virtual event will take place in two City Parks, Monument Valley Park and Palmer Park, creating the Two Shoes Trek Challenge 2021 Hybrid.

This event showcases several county and city trails throughout our unique and beautiful landscape. Participants will run a 5-mile, 10-mile, or 15-mile course virtually on September 4, 5, or 6 in either Monument Valley Park or Palmer Park. The following weekend a live event will be held in Fox Run Regional Park. Participants will have the opportunity to run a 5k, 10k, or 30k. All proceeds from these events will go directly back into the Colorado Springs community for park and trail maintenance and to help PPRR with its mission of cultivating health and fitness in the Pikes Peak region through a community of runners and friends.

All donations will be split between El Paso County Parks, Trails and Open Space Coalition, and Pikes Peak Road Runners.
